Plasma Gasification Vitrification Reactor (PGVR)

WPC‘s proprietary Plasma Gasification Vitrification Reactor (PGVR) design, is the combination of a moving bed gasifier with WPC’s proven industrial plasma torch technology.

  • Operation at ambient pressures allowing for simple feed systems and online maintenance of the plasma torches
  • Low gas velocities allowing for greater feed flexibility and eliminating most expensive pre-treatments of feed stock
  • Environmentally friendly operation since syngas that is created has very low quantities of NOx, SOx, dioxins and furans
  • Inorganic components get converted to molten slag which is removed as vitrified by-product – safe for use as a construction aggregate
  • High reliability - plasma torches have no moving parts. Torch consumables are quickly replaced by plant maintenance personnel
  • Syngas composition (H2 to CO ratio, N2) can be matched to downstream process equipment by selection of oxidant and torch power consumption
